From policy to administration : essays in honour of William A. Robson / edited by J. A. G. Griffith.

Contributor(s): Robson, William Alexander, 1895-1980 | Griffith, J. A. GMaterial type: TextTextPublication details: London : Allen & Unwin, 1976. Description: 216 p. ; 22 cmISBN: 0043500501 :Subject(s): Robson, William Alexander, 1895-1980 | Great Britain -- Politics and government -- 20th centuryDDC classification: 342.6
Contents:
Jones, G. W. The Prime Minister's secretaries: politicians or administrators?--Friedrich, C. J. Reflections on democracy and bureaucracy.--Crick, B. Participation and the future of government.--Self, P. Rational decentralization.--Macintosh, J. P. The problems of devolution--the Scottish case.--Sharpe, L. J. Instrumental participation and urban government.--Foster, C. D. The public corporation: allocative efficiency and x-efficiency.--Mitchell, J. D. B. Administrative law and policy effectiveness.--Griffith, J. A. G. Justice and administrative law revisited.
